AI Contract Overview
This contract is a solicitation from the Department of Defense ASC Commodities Division for the procurement of 426 blind rivets, specifically part number NAS1750-3DL2 under NSN 5320-01-339-1956. The items must adhere to AIA/NAS NAS1750 and NAS1675 specifications, with part marking following MIL-STD-130 and SAE AS478. Delivery is required within 182 days after order, and the contract mandates inspection and acceptance at the origin. Compliance requirements include CMMC Level 2 self-assessment and adherence to covered defense information protocols. Technical standards are governed by ASME Y14.5 for dimensions and tolerances, and the use of Class 1 ODS is strictly prohibited. The contractor must utilize the most current amendments for all applicable military and industry specifications. Additionally, any release of data to foreign-owned or influenced companies requires approval from the Foreign Disclosure Office.

Full Description
RIVET, BLIND
RA001: THIS DOCUMENT INCORPORATES TECHNICAL AND/OR QUALITY REQUIREMENTS
(IDENTIFIED BY AN 'R' OR AN 'I' NUMBER) SET FORTH IN FULL TEXT IN THE
DLA MASTER LIST OF TECHNICAL AND QUALITY REQUIREMENTS FOUND ON THE WEB
AT:
http://www.dla.mil/HQ/Acquisition/Offers/eProcurement.aspx http://www.dla.mil/HQ/Acquisition/Offers/eProcurement.aspx
FOR SIMPLIFIED ACQUISITIONS, THE REVISION OF THE MASTER IN EFFECT ON THE SOLICITATION ISSUE DATE OR THE AWARD DATE CONTROLS. FOR LARGE ACQUISITIONS, THE REVISION OF THE MASTER IN EFFECT ON THE RFP ISSUE DATE APPLIES UNLESS A SOLICITATION AMENDMENT INCORPORATES A FOLLOW-ON REVISION, IN WHICH CASE THE AMENDMENT DATE CONTROLS.
RD002, COVERED DEFENSE INFORMATION APPLIES
RD004: Cybersecurity Maturity Model Certification (CMMC) Level 2 Self-Assessment RP001: DLA PACKAGING REQUIREMENTS FOR PROCUREMENT
RQ001: TAILORED HIGHER LEVEL CONTRACT QUALITY REQUIREMENTS
(MANUFACTURERS AND NON-MANUFACTURERS)
RQ009: INSPECTION AND ACCEPTANCE AT ORIGIN
RQ011: REMOVAL OF GOVERNMENT IDENTIFICATION FROM NON-ACCEPTED SUPPLIES
RQ017: PHYSICAL INDENTIFICATION/BARE ITEM MARKING
ENGINEERING NOTES & EXCEPTIONS:
1. DWG AIA/NAS NAS1750: PART NUMBER: NAS1750-3DL2, EN: 1 THRU 5.
2. NAS1750-3DL2 BLIND RIVET PER AIA/NAS NAS1750 AND PROCUREMENT
SPECIFICATION AIA/NAS NAS1675.
3. PART MARKING IAW MIL-STD-130, METHOD PER SAE AS478.
4. DIMENSIONS AND TOLERANCES PER ASME Y14.5 IN LIEU OF ANSI Y14.5.
5. RELEASE OF THIS DATA TO A FOREIGN-OWNED, CONTROLLED OR INFLUENCED
COMPANY IS DEPENDENT UPON THE APPROVAL OF THE FOREIGN DISCLOSURE OFFICE.
6. REFERENCE ALL DETAIL AND OR TIERED DRAWINGS, SPECIFICATIONS AND
DOCUMENTS: THE REQUIRED USE OF A CLASS 1 ODS AS DEFINED IN CLAUSE H-305
AND OR L-513 IS PROHIBITED. THE CONTRACTOR MUST USE
THE ALTERNATE PROCESSES AND OR CHEMICALS SPECIFIED IN THE APPLICABLE
DRAWINGS, SPECIFICATIONS AND DOCUMENTS.
7. THE CONTRACTOR SHALL USE THE MOST CURRENT AMENDMENTS APPLICABLE TO
EACH MIL SPEC, MIL STD, INDUSTRY SPEC OR INDUSTRY STD AS OF THE
EFFECTIVE DATE OF THIS CONTRACT UNLESS OTHERWISE NOTED.
CRITICAL ITEM APPLICATION
ORIGIN INSPECTION REQUIRED
THIS NSN IS PROCURED AS FULLY COMPETITIVE IN
ACCORDANCE WITH A MILITARY / FEDERAL
SPECIFICATION/STANDARD. SEE NSN/Part Number: 5320-01-339-1956 Quantity: 426 EA Purchase Request: 7017766058QTY: 426 Delivery: 182 days ADO
